John R. Hand
In the realm of independent horror and science fiction cinema, John R. Hand stands as a distinctive voice. Born in 1970 in Pensacola, Florida, USA, Hand has been active in the film industry since the late 1990s, mainly focusing on horror, science fiction, and experimental genres. His most recognized works include "Scars of Youth" and "Frankenstein's Bloody Nightmare," neither of which, despite their cult status, have clinched awards at major film festivals.
